Registered Nurse (RN) - ICU/PCU Float
Location: Roanoke, Virginia
Employment Type: Travel/Contract
Contract Length: 13 weeks
Position Overview
- Float between ICU and PCU units; must be comfortable working all ICU and PCU units.
- Schedule: 3 shifts of 12 hours each (6:45 PM - 7:15 AM).
- Floating may occur 2-3 times per shift (every 4 hours).
- Weekend requirement: Every other weekend or 6 weekend shifts in a 6-week block.
- Holiday requirement: Must work one holiday per 13-week contract.
- EPIC charting experience required.
- Accepts first-time travelers.
- Pending license accepted only if holding a single-state license from a non-compact state; otherwise, active Virginia State or Compact RN/LPN license required.
Required Certifications
- ACLS (Advanced Cardiac Life Support)
- BLS (Basic Life Support)
- NIHSS (National Institutes of Health Stroke Scale)
Required Clinical Skills
- IV therapy: arterial line management, central/PICC line care, blood product administration, IV initiation & maintenance
- Respiratory support: BiPAP & CPAP management, ventilated patient care
- Medication administration: continuous IV sedation, emergency meds, titration of cardiac & vasoactive drips
- Wound care: surgical wounds with drains or wound vacs
- Cardiac monitoring: dysrhythmia interpretation & management
- Endocrine/metabolic: IV insulin protocol adherence
- ICU experience required
- Experience at a large Level 1 or Level 2 facility required
- Preferred: 2+ years of experience
Unit Details
- PCU average nurse-to-patient ratio: 5:1
- ICU average nurse-to-patient ratio: 2:1

About Roanoke, VA
As a Travel Intensive Care Unit Nurse in Roanoke, VA here's what you should know:Cost of Living
- The cost of living in Roanoke is lower than the national average, making it an affordable place to live.
- Wages generally match up with the lower cost of living.
Weather
- Average summer highs range from 80-85°F, while winter lows average around 25-30°F.
- Roanoke experiences all four seasons, with mild to moderate temperatures throughout the year.
Furnished Housing
- Short term rentals are relatively easy to find in Roanoke, with various options available for furnished housing to accommodate travel nurses.
Transportation
- Roanoke is car-friendly, with a well-maintained road network.
- Public transportation options are available, including buses and trolleys, but a car is generally recommended for convenience.
Demographics
- Roanoke has a diverse population with a wide age range.
- Common health issues include obesity and related conditions, as well as respiratory ailments.
- There is a growing population of travel nurses due to the presence of multiple healthcare facilities.
Things to Do
- Roanoke offers a vibrant culinary scene with diverse restaurants, along with art galleries, museums, and live music venues.
- Outdoor enthusiasts can explore the extensive network of trails for hiking and biking, as well as access to national forests for fishing, paddling, and wildlife watching.
